Output c6d98057aac368e5586726ace9200e57a89cd0805a0bfd5e81df385d36ebdaaf:0

value
22518545
script pubkey
OP_0 OP_PUSHBYTES_20 b95ba14f2c0887229e645f462fbb2bd03a5428e3
address
bc1qh9d6znevpzrj98nytarzlwet6qa9g28rrpfwed
transaction
c6d98057aac368e5586726ace9200e57a89cd0805a0bfd5e81df385d36ebdaaf
confirmations
133873
spent
true